首页 » 电脑故障维修 » 卡屏的代码大全软件卡顿背后的秘密

卡屏的代码大全软件卡顿背后的秘密

duote123 2025-03-17 0

扫一扫用手机浏览

文章目录 [+]

我们的生活已经离不开各种软件和应用程序。在使用过程中,我们时常会遇到软件卡顿、卡屏等问题,给我们的工作和生活带来诸多不便。为了解决这一问题,本文将深入剖析卡屏的代码大全,揭秘软件卡顿背后的秘密。

一、卡屏的成因

卡屏的代码大全软件卡顿背后的秘密 电脑故障维修

1. 硬件问题

硬件设备老化、性能不足是导致软件卡屏的重要原因之一。例如,内存不足、处理器速度慢、显卡性能不足等,都会导致软件在运行时出现卡顿现象。

2. 软件问题

(1)代码编写问题:在软件编写过程中,程序员可能由于疏忽或经验不足,导致代码存在缺陷,从而引发卡屏现象。

(2)资源占用过多:软件在运行过程中,若占用过多系统资源,如CPU、内存等,会导致其他程序运行缓慢,甚至出现卡屏。

(3)兼容性问题:不同版本的操作系统、驱动程序或硬件设备之间可能存在兼容性问题,导致软件运行不稳定,出现卡屏。

3. 系统问题

(1)系统配置不合理:系统配置不合理,如虚拟内存设置过低、磁盘碎片过多等,会导致系统运行缓慢,进而引发卡屏。

(2)系统漏洞:系统漏洞容易被恶意软件利用,导致系统资源被占用过多,从而引发卡屏。

二、卡屏的代码大全解析

1. 代码优化

(1)避免使用大量的循环和递归:循环和递归在代码中会导致程序执行时间增加,从而引发卡屏。例如,可以使用循环优化技术,如迭代而非递归。

(2)合理使用内存:避免在代码中频繁创建和销毁对象,减少内存占用。

(3)优化算法:选择高效的算法,降低程序执行时间。

2. 资源管理

(1)合理分配系统资源:合理分配CPU、内存、磁盘等系统资源,避免资源占用过多。

(2)及时释放资源:在程序运行过程中,及时释放不再使用的资源,减少内存占用。

3. 异常处理

(1)捕获并处理异常:在代码中添加异常处理机制,避免程序在遇到异常时崩溃。

(2)记录异常信息:记录异常信息,便于排查问题。

三、如何解决卡屏问题

1. 检查硬件设备

(1)升级硬件设备:若硬件设备老化或性能不足,可考虑升级硬件设备。

(2)优化硬件配置:根据实际需求,调整硬件配置,如内存、CPU等。

2. 更新软件

(1)升级操作系统:确保操作系统版本为最新,修复系统漏洞。

(2)更新驱动程序:更新硬件设备的驱动程序,提高兼容性。

3. 优化软件

(1)修复代码缺陷:对软件进行代码审查,修复潜在的缺陷。

(2)降低资源占用:优化软件资源管理,降低资源占用。

4. 清理系统

(1)清理磁盘碎片:定期清理磁盘碎片,提高系统运行速度。

(2)卸载无关软件:卸载占用系统资源过多的无关软件。

卡屏问题一直是困扰广大用户的一大难题。通过对卡屏的代码大全进行分析,我们可以了解到卡屏的成因及解决方法。在今后的工作和生活中,我们应关注软件卡顿问题,采取有效措施解决卡屏,提高软件运行效率,提升用户体验。

标签:

相关文章

SEO优化服务哪家经验丰富,值得信赖

企业对网络营销的需求日益增长,SEO优化服务成为了企业提升网站排名、获取流量、提高转化率的重要手段。面对市场上众多的SEO优化服务...

电脑故障维修 2025-04-11 阅读0 评论0

SEO优化误区,助力网站优化之路

搜索引擎优化(SEO)已成为企业提升网站排名、获取更多流量、提高品牌知名度的关键手段。在SEO优化过程中,许多企业和个人却陷入了一...

电脑故障维修 2025-04-11 阅读0 评论0